Create your own stunning flowers from paper with these 35 step-by-step projects
Decorate your home using techniques such as simple origami, layered dcoupage, papier mch and quilling. Using everyday giftwrap, colourful pages torn from glossy magazines, paper napkins and tissue paper to handmade paper, parchment paper and crinkly crepe paper, Denise Brown guides you through the process of making perfect paper flowers. You can display the flowers in vases, create bouquets and posies to give as gifts, use them to decorate gift boxes and greetings cards, or create wall hangings and window displays. Whether your taste is rooted in Simple yet Stunning, where you will find Oriental Poppies and Frilly Fancies, or Bright and Beautiful, with projects such as Vibrant Dahlias and Waterlilies, or finally, Sophisticated Style, where you can make a Peony Wreath or Elegant Lilies, you will be sure to find the perfect project.
Denise Brown studied graphic design and began her career in book design and packaging, before becoming creative director of her own company. Crafting has always been one of her passions and she now teaches a range of crafts, including papercrafts, drawing and painting. Denise is the author of Paper Jewelry, and 101 Things To Do with An Envelope, both published by CICO Books. The author is based in Seattle, WA, USA.
